Career path

Career Role (Financial Mathematics) Description
Quantitative Analyst (Quant) Develop and implement sophisticated mathematical models for financial markets; high demand for strong programming skills (Python, R).
Financial Engineer Design and build financial instruments and trading strategies using advanced mathematical techniques; strong problem-solving and analytical abilities are key.
Data Scientist (Finance) Analyze large financial datasets to extract insights and inform investment decisions; expertise in statistical modeling and machine learning essential.
Actuary Assess and manage financial risks, particularly in insurance and pensions; requires strong mathematical and statistical knowledge combined with business acumen.
Risk Manager Identify, assess, and mitigate financial risks; advanced knowledge of probability and statistical modeling is crucial for effective risk assessment.
